LifeKnight, Inc. Selected as Finalist for 2025 SXSW Pitch

TRAVERSE CITY, Mich., Jan. 22, 2025 /PRNewswire/ — LifeKnight, Inc., a pioneer in AI-enabled safety and health technology, has been named a finalist in the Space, Government & Security category for the 2025 SXSW Pitch. The event, presented by KPMG, showcases the most innovative global startups during the South by Southwest® (SXSW®) Conference & Festivals in Austin, TX, March 7-15, 2025.

Out of 589 applicants, LifeKnight, Inc. is one of 45 finalists across nine categories and will present on March 8, 2025. The company will showcase its AI-enabled LifeKnight Safety and Wellness Platform, which powers the LOIS Safety App, AI agents, and advanced health and safety features. This platform offers groundbreaking capabilities such as real-time emergency detection, automated response, geo-fencing for hazardous areas, and continuous health monitoring.

“Being selected as a finalist is a significant milestone,” said Avery Piantedosi, Founder and CEO of LifeKnight, Inc. “Our platform redefines safety and wellness by leveraging AI to proactively protect lives and transform emergency response.”

LifeKnight, Inc.’s innovations are supported by strategic partnerships with IBM Watson and NVIDIA, emphasizing its leadership in AI-enabled safety technology.

SXSW Pitch will culminate in an awards ceremony on March 9, where category winners and a Best in Show winner will be announced.
